ptmv - a commandline app that plays videos and displays images
I'm working on a project ptmv, in order to improve my python skills. It can display images and play both local and youtube videos (using youtube-dl). The performance is reasonable and it uses full 8 bit colors. It's an old project I recently updated in order to refresh my python skills, so any feedback is welcome.

After years on Linux, I just discovered Vim & TMUX. They're fucking amazing.
For absolute revelation, use vtm, a whole Desktop environment for the terminal. In addition to tiling (like tmux) it supports floating window management.
